Ambulatory Quality Program Manager - RN
Located in: North Central New Mexico
Schedule: Full-Time
Salary Range: Competitive pay, based on experience and qualifications.
As an Ambulatory Quality Program Manager, you will lead quality and performance improvement initiatives across outpatient settings, ensuring high standards of patient care. Under the direction of the Director of Quality and Executive Director of Ambulatory Nursing, you will collaborate with clinical leaders to standardize workflows, enhance compliance, and implement evidence-based practices. Supporting clinic managers and directors, you will drive policy integration, staff education, and continuous quality improvement. Quality Program Manager Key Responsibilities
- Lead and implement quality improvement initiatives within ambulatory care services.
- Evaluate patient care processes to ensure regulatory compliance and best practices.
- Work closely with nursing staff, physicians, and leadership to enhance quality and safety.
- Analyze clinical data and performance metrics to identify areas for improvement.
- Develop and conduct training programs to support nursing staff in quality efforts.
- Assist in policy development, risk management, and accreditation processes.
Role Qualifications
- Graduate of an accredited nursing program (BSN preferred).
- Active RN license in New Mexico or Compact state.
- BLS certification required; certification in quality or risk management preferred.
- Minimum 5 years of nursing experience in ambulatory or clinical settings, with at least 2 years in quality improvement.
- Strong problem-solving, data analysis, and leadership abilities.
- Experience in regulatory compliance, performance improvement, and evidence-based practices.
